Exploring The Penguin's Biography

Personal Background and Early Life

Before diving into the intricacies of The Penguin's character, it's important to understand the personal history that shaped him. Oswald Chesterfield Cobblepot, better known as The Penguin, was born with distinct physical traits, including a short stature and flipper-like hands, which earned him his infamous nickname. These features not only defined his appearance but also influenced his life from an early age. Below is a table summarizing key details about his background:

Understanding The Penguin's Origins

The Penguin's origins are steeped in tragedy, shaped by a life of hardship and rejection. Born into a family struggling financially, Oswald faced both emotional and physical abuse from a young age. His deformities made him a target for ridicule, isolating him further from society. The loss of his sister in an accident only deepened his loneliness, fueling his desire for power and recognition. These early experiences forged the foundation of his personality and ambitions, driving him to rise above his circumstances and assert his dominance in Gotham City.

Key Characteristics of The Penguin

What sets The Penguin apart from other Batman villains is his distinct personality and traits. He is a highly intelligent and manipulative strategist, often using his sharp wit to outsmart opponents. Despite his physical limitations, The Penguin maintains an air of sophistication, dressed impeccably in elegant suits and carrying a distinctive umbrella that doubles as a weapon. The Penguin's Role in Comics

Early Appearances in the Comics

The Penguin made his debut in Detective Comics #58 in December 1941, created by the legendary Bob Kane and Bill Finger. From the very beginning, he was portrayed as a cunning criminal with a penchant for elaborate schemes. Over the decades, his character evolved, transitioning from a mere henchman to a formidable crime lord in Gotham City. His role became increasingly complex, reflecting the changing nature of the Batman universe.

The Penguin in Film Adaptations

The cinematic portrayal of The Penguin began with "Batman Returns" in 1992, where Danny DeVito delivered a memorable performance, emphasizing the character's tragic backstory and transformation into a villain. More recently, Colin Farrell brought The Penguin to life in "The Batman" (2022), showcasing his rise to power in Gotham's underworld. These films have played a crucial role in cementing The Penguin's status as a central figure in the Batman universe, captivating audiences worldwide.

The Penguin in Television Series

Television series such as "Gotham" have explored The Penguin's early life and his ascent to power. Robin Lord Taylor's portrayal of The Penguin in "Gotham" garnered critical acclaim for its depth and complexity. The series delved into his struggles and triumphs, offering viewers a comprehensive understanding of his character and the forces that shaped him. The Penguin's Dynamic with Batman

The relationship between The Penguin and Batman is multifaceted, marked by both conflict and cooperation. While they are adversaries, there are instances where they collaborate to achieve mutual goals, blurring the lines between hero and villain. This dynamic reflects the broader theme of duality that permeates the Batman universe, where the boundaries between good and evil are often ambiguous. Their interactions add depth to the narrative, making their relationship one of the most intriguing aspects of the series.
